Victor Victori (born August 16, 1943) is a portraitist, painter, sculptor, author and ordained Minister originally from South Korea. Victori immigrated to the U.S. in 1972 and took on his first project, his presidential mural of all the past and up to date(1972) American presidents which currently resides in the White House Collection. After completing the "Presidential Mural," Victori travelled the country doing shows and exhibitions for 20 years from coast to coast.
